Who needs multivitamins?

Whilst a 'balanced' diet will supply all the necessary nutrients we need, our busy lifestyles can mean that people do not receive all the nutrients required in the right quantities every day to maintain good health. Nutritionists recommend eating at least five portions of fruit and vegetables every day. This is often difficult to achieve.

There are many groups of people who may benefit from additional vitamins:

  • Infants and children
  • Adolescents
  • The elderly
  • Women of child-bearing age
  • Those individuals with limited exposure to sunlight, as they may be at risk from a lack of vitamin D
  • Individuals who are following a slimming diet
  • Strict vegetarians and vegans
  • Food faddists
  • People with busy lifestyles who find it difficult to eat a balanced diet every day
  • Athletes in training
